CCTV CAMERAS MAKES WARRNAMBOOL SAFER

A new CCTV system officially launched in Warrnambool today will help police keep a closer eye on crime and create a safer entertainment precinct. The Warrnambool City Council received $168,000 from the Victorian Government to install nine closed circuit TV cameras across seven sites in Warrnambool’s late night entertainment precinct.
